function[change] = delta(ct,mt,y,b)// The delta function is the non-uniform distributions used by the nonUniform// mutations.  This function returns a change based on the current gen, the// max gen and the amount of possible deviation.//// function[change] = delta(ct,mt,y,b)// ct - current generation// mt - maximum generation// y  - maximum amount of change, i.e. distance from parameter value to bounds// b  - shape parameter// Binary and Real-Valued Simulation Evolution for Matlab // Copyright (C) 1996 C.R. Houck, J.A. Joines, M.G. Kay //// C.R. Houck, J.Joines, and M.Kay. A genetic algorithm for function// optimization: A Matlab implementation.
